Buying Guide for the Best Small Business Routers

Choosing the right router for your small business is crucial for ensuring a reliable and secure network. A good router can help manage multiple devices, provide strong security features, and ensure fast and stable internet connectivity. When selecting a router, consider the size of your business, the number of devices that will be connected, and the specific needs of your operations. Here are some key specifications to consider when choosing a small business router.
SpeedSpeed refers to the maximum data transfer rate of the router, usually measured in megabits per second (Mbps) or gigabits per second (Gbps). This is important because it determines how quickly data can be transmitted and received over your network. For small businesses, a router with speeds of at least 300 Mbps is generally sufficient for basic tasks like web browsing and email. However, if your business relies on high-bandwidth activities such as video conferencing, large file transfers, or cloud-based applications, you may need a router with speeds of 1 Gbps or higher. Assess your business activities to determine the appropriate speed for your needs.
CoverageCoverage refers to the area that the router's wireless signal can reach. This is important for ensuring that all areas of your business have a strong and reliable Wi-Fi connection. Routers with higher coverage are equipped with more powerful antennas and can cover larger areas. For small offices or retail spaces, a standard router with a coverage range of up to 1,500 square feet may be sufficient. For larger spaces or multi-story buildings, consider a router with a coverage range of 2,500 square feet or more, or look into mesh networking systems that can extend coverage throughout your entire business premises.
Security FeaturesSecurity features are essential for protecting your business network from cyber threats. Look for routers that offer robust security protocols such as WPA3 encryption, firewall protection, and VPN support. These features help safeguard sensitive business data and prevent unauthorized access. Additionally, some routers come with built-in security software that can detect and block malware, phishing attempts, and other online threats. Evaluate the level of security your business requires based on the sensitivity of the data you handle and the potential risks you face.
Number of PortsThe number of ports on a router determines how many wired devices can be connected directly to it. This is important for businesses that use multiple wired devices such as desktop computers, printers, and network storage devices. Most small business routers come with at least four Ethernet ports, which is usually sufficient for basic needs. If your business has a higher number of wired devices, look for routers with more ports or consider using a network switch to expand the number of available connections. Assess the number of wired devices in your business to determine the appropriate number of ports.
Dual-Band vs. Tri-BandDual-band routers operate on two frequency bands (2.4 GHz and 5 GHz), while tri-band routers add an additional 5 GHz band. This is important for managing network traffic and reducing interference. Dual-band routers are suitable for most small businesses, providing a good balance between range and speed. The 2.4 GHz band offers better range but slower speeds, while the 5 GHz band offers faster speeds but shorter range. Tri-band routers are beneficial for businesses with a high number of connected devices or those that require high-speed connections for multiple tasks simultaneously. Consider the number of devices and the type of activities your business engages in to decide between dual-band and tri-band.
Quality of Service (QoS)Quality of Service (QoS) is a feature that allows you to prioritize certain types of network traffic, ensuring that critical applications receive the necessary bandwidth. This is important for businesses that rely on specific applications such as VoIP, video conferencing, or online transactions. QoS can help prevent network congestion and ensure smooth performance for essential tasks. If your business has specific applications that require consistent and reliable performance, look for routers with advanced QoS settings that allow you to customize traffic prioritization based on your needs.
